Transaction 295186a7de27da57245dabbb351ed6bb511009ba8d09dda27f3dd69f1bf86b13
3 Input
2 Outputs
- 295186a7de27da57245dabbb351ed6bb511009ba8d09dda27f3dd69f1bf86b13:0
- 295186a7de27da57245dabbb351ed6bb511009ba8d09dda27f3dd69f1bf86b13:1
value 1258073
address 17EdW87ZCu2fnN7D6KpLoq76n9M34hXYUh
value 62628354
address 124koUKyfNGNz6bbtHnQaNYWsZxbkEYzbu